As its name suggests, Edgewater sits on the shore of Lake Michigan, just six miles north of the Loop. the area is served by the CTA’s Red Line and city buses. But for those who prefer to drive, North Lake Shore Drive provides a scenic drive for commuters. The spectacular shoreline includes part of Chicago’s largest green space, Lincoln Park, which is lined with several public beaches. Once the place for summer homes of Chicago’s elite, the lake side now boasts luxury high-rise apartments and condos, interspersed with pockets of historic districts. Away from the lake you’ll find single-family homes and multiple flat houses. In Edgewater, visitors can antique shop at the Broadway Antique Shop or Edgewater Antique Mall, or stroll the Bryn Mawr Historic District, a reminder of 1920’s Chicago. A diverse population means diverse dining, with delis, boutique groceries and specialty farm stands. The innovative storefront theater district offers a variety of shows. With low crime, top schools and spectacular nature, Edgewater is truly one of Chicago’s premier neighborhoods.

What Size and Style of Garage Do You Need?

The roof style of a detached garage is an important consideration for both aesthetic beauty and function, and Fisher Garages will help you choose the best style and garage size for your new garage structure.

Hip Roof
A gentle slope on all four sides presents a pyramid shape with a low -profile roof line that does not compete with the line of the house. The low line is good for high-wind areas, or areas where the view is important.

Gable Roof
The triangle-shaped roof with front and back gables offers a steeper pitch for efficient rain and snow runoff and could include some storage. The angle of the gable can also be designed to blend with the home’s rooflines.

Reverse Gable Roof
Here the triangular gables are at the sides, offering a longer line side to side. Like the gable roof, the pitch also allows for storage and efficient runoff. In addition, gable windows can be added along the front to match your home’s design.
